Q: Is 4,776,694 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,776,694 is a composite number.

Why is 4,776,694 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,776,694 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 17 26 34 101 107 202 214 221 442 1,313 1,391 1,717 1,819 2,626 2,782 3,434 3,638 10,807 21,614 22,321 23,647 44,642 47,294 140,491 183,719 280,982 367,438 2,388,347 and 4,776,694, with no remainder.

Since 4,776,694 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,776,694, it is a composite number.
